A fantastic size, three bedroom detached bungalow, located within the favoured village of Rhuddlan being conveniently situated within walking distance to the stunning Castle, shops, bus routes and schools.
The accommodation is in need of some internal decoration comprises good size living room with feature fireplace, fitted kitchen with large pantry, two double bedrooms, bedroom one with fitted wardrobes, single 3rd bedroom and a spacious three piece shower room.
Outside it boasts ample off street parking on a brick paved driveway, single detached garage with power and a lovely size, enclosed rear garden with timber summerhouse enjoying a sunny aspect.
Viewings are essential to appreciate the village its located in, the size of this bungalow and the lovely quiet street its located on.
Available with freehold tenure, council tax band - D, freehold tenure & EPC Rating D-64.
